The History Museum of Marseille is a French city history museum with a history of 2,600 years. After the overall renovation, the Marseille History Museum has become one of the largest history museums in Europe. This building, built on the ruins of an ancient port, was renovated by designer Roland Carta with 260 meters of glass mesh throughout, and it has witnessed the changes of Marseille over the past 2,600 years.

The collection of the Musé ed''HistoiredeMarseille Marseille History Museum is very deep. Roman architectural relics, ancient ship models, etc. show the process of Marseille being influenced by different cultures in historical evolution and slowly forming its own unique cultural style.
